Album Description
Max Richter's 'Voices' is a profound and emotive album, released on 21 May 2021, under the Decca label. This neoclassical, minimalist, and classical masterpiece, infused with ambient textures, is a culmination of 20 tracks, spanning 1 hour and 42 minutes. The album is a deeply personal and poignant work, inspired by the Universal Declaration of Human Rights.
The music is characterised by its soothing and contemplative nature, with tracks such as 'All Human Beings', 'Chorale', and 'Murmuration' showcasing Max Richter's ability to craft intricate and emotionally charged soundscapes. The album features a range of instruments, including the cello, played by Mari Samuelsen, and is accompanied by the subtle yet effective direction of Robert Ziegler.
'Voices' is a companion to Max Richter's previous work, with 'Voices 2' being released shortly after, featuring instrumental reworkings of the original themes. The album has been praised for its mesmerising quality, with many noting its ability to evoke a sense of calm and reflection. Max Richter's 'Voices' is a testament to the composer's innovative and thought-provoking approach to music, and is sure to resonate with fans of classical and ambient genres.

About Max Richter
Max Richter, the German-born British composer and pianist, is renowned for his evocative compositions that blend postminimalist and contemporary classical styles. With a classical training background from the University of Edinburgh, the Royal Academy of Music in London, and studies under the legendary Luciano Berio, Richter's music is both deeply rooted in tradition and refreshingly innovative. His discography spans nine solo albums, each offering a unique sonic journey that has captivated audiences worldwide. Beyond his studio work, Richter's compositions have graced the silver screen in films like "Arrival" and television shows such as "The Leftovers," showcasing his versatility across various media.
